In February, philanthropist Laurie Erickson hosted the launch of WV Women Moving Forward, an effort to empower women in the workplace. Data show that our state's economy cannot thrive without greater participation by talented women. The effort is moving full steam ahead to take action on issues including education, wages and workforce barriers. Stay tuned for a six-month progress report this August!
